NettetA doorstop (also door stopper, door stop or door wedge) is an object or device used to hold a door open or closed, or to prevent a door from opening too widely. The same word is used to refer to a thin slat built inside a door frame to prevent a door from swinging through when closed. Nettet12. jun. 2024 · If the door is sticking to the frame due to loose screws holding the hinge, the solution is to simply tighten the screws using a screwdriver, power drill, or impact driver. If your house (and so the door) is very old, it’s possible that the screw holes have gotten enlarged and therefore are unable to hold the screws tightly.
